Q: How to change an Automatic Transmission Filter on 2005 Chrysler PT Cruiser?
A: Check the recommended service schedules to know when you need to change your car's fluid and filter. Make sure to use only Mopar ATF+4 for your transmission maintenance and be sure to replace the filter at the same time, while cleaning the magnet in the oil pan with a clean cloth. If the transaxle is removed, pull out the fluid and put in a new filter. First, lift the vehicle using a hoist and put a drain container under the transaxle oil pan. While you undo the bolts on the pan, lightly tap one corner so the pan breaks free and the excess fluid can drain, before taking it off. Install fresh filters and O-rings on the bottom of the valve body, clean the oil pan and magnet and put the pan back in using fresh Mopar Silicone Adhesive sealant, with each bolt tightened to 19 Nm. Add four quarts of Mopar ATF+4 through the dipstick opening, turn the engine on and let it run for one minute. With the brakes on, shift the selector lever briefly through every level, then stop it in park or neutral. Examine the level of transaxle fluid and replenish it until there is 3 mm (1/8 inch) of fluid below the lowest line on the dipstick. Then check the level again after the transaxle reaches 180°F. Push the dipstick in firmly to seal the transaxle and stop problems caused by dirt. First, let the transaxle heat up properly, select a proper fluid suction device, push the suction tube into the dipstick tube and confirm it arrives at the lowest part of the oil pan. Use the manufacturer's instructions to take out the fluid, pull out the suction line, insert four quarts of Mopar ATF+4 through the dipstick opening, fire up the engine and check the fluid level as you did in the first stage.
